Distinguished personnel from the U.S. and Tunisian Armed Forces gather in the Ben Ghilouf Training Area to watch as the joint, combined team demonstrates their proficiency in cooperative, large-scale operations using both ground and air assets to assault designated targets in Ben Ghilouf, Tunisia, on May 10, 2024. African Lion 2024 marks the 20th anniversary of U.S. Africa Command’s premier joint exercise led by U.S. Army Southern European Task Force, Africa (SETAF-AF), running from April 19 to May 31 across Ghana, Morocco, Senegal, and Tunisia, with over 8,100 participants from 27 nations and NATO contingents.
